The “When We Were Young: A Novel (The Baxter Family)” is a great, fiction that shows what happens when one person ignores advice in marriage. Karen Kingsbury is the author of this best-selling novel. Karen Kingsbury is America’s favorite inspirational storyteller, with more than twenty-five million copies of her award-winning books in print. In this book, Karen Kingsbury describes the Baxter family. Noah and Emily Carter loved to one another. They arranged a beautiful engagement and a Lavish wedding. They live a happy and lovely life with care. They want the world to know about their lovely relationships.
Noah shares pictures of marriage on Instagram, Twitter, and Facebook. Millions of followers later and Noah is obsessed with staged photos and encouraging posts, Noah thinks of nothing else. Emily turns to Kari Baxter Taylor, hoping for some advice on what to do, to help her marriage survive. Because she wants her husband back from social media. She wants the father to her children back, but Noah spends more time on his computer talking to his adoring. To know about further, can Emily will receive her husband and children’s father back?
